Designer dogs have become a bit of a trend in recent years. When I say designer dog, I mean a dog that comes from two purebreds as opposed to a mutt which is a blend of two or more breeds. I'm talking about your Labradoodles (Labrador plus poodle), Goldendoodles (Golden Retriever plus poodle), puggles (Pug and beagle) and cavachons (Cavalier King Charles Spaniel + Bichon Frise) of the dog world. Or how about a Malitpoos (a mixture of a Maltese and a Poodle). In fact there are about 500 designer dog breeds nowadays, most of which have fancy, even ridiculous, sounding names.
You might be wondering how their lives compare with those of mutts and purebreds. Well, according to this infographic from Pet CareRx, they live longer believe it or not. And they cost 25 to 50% more than purebreds.
